Ingredients List
- 1 box of yellow cake mix
- 1 can of strawberry pie filling
- 1 package of c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up of butter, melted
- 1/2 cup of sugar
- 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ract

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your cake bakes evenly and comes out perfectly golden.
- Mix the Cream Cheese Mixture: In a medium-sized b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, sugar, and vanilla extract. Use an electric mixer or a sturdy whisk to blend everything until it’s smooth and creamy. Trust me, this step is super important because it gives that cheesecake goodness to the cake!
- Prepare the Baking Dish: Grab a greased 9×13-inch baking dish. You want to make sure it’s well-greased so your cake doesn’t stick. I like to use cooking spray for an easy release!
- Layer the Strawberry Filling: Spread the can of strawberry pie filling evenly across the bottom of your prepared dish. This fruity layer is going to soak into the cake and keep it moist!
- Add the Cream Cheese Mixture: Carefully pour the cream cheese mixture over the strawberry filling. Use a spatula to gently spread it out, covering the strawberries as best as you can. It doesn’t have to be perfect; it’ll all meld together in the oven!
- Top with Cake Mix: Now, here comes the fun part! Sprinkle the dry yellow cake mix evenly over the cream cheese layer. Don’t mix it—just let it sit on top like a cozy blanket!
- Drizzle with Butter: Finally, drizzle your melted butter all over the cake mix. This step helps create that delicious, golden crust as it bakes. Oh, the smell is going to be heavenly!
- Bake: Pop your dish into the preheated oven and bake for 45-50 minutes. Keep an eye on it towards the end! You want it to be golden brown and set in the center. A toothpick inserted should come out with a few moist crumbs, not wet batter.
- Cool and Serve: Let your cake cool for a bit before serving. I love it warm, but it’s also fantastic chilled. Just scoop out a slice, and enjoy the deliciousness!

Tips for Success
To make sure your strawberry cheesecake dump cake turns out perfectly every time, here are some handy tips to keep in mind!
First, use softened cream cheese for the smoothest mixture. Don’t rush this step; letting it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es works wonders! You want it creamy, not chunky.
Next, keep an eye on the baking time. Ovens can vary, so start checking for doneness at the 45-minute mark. You’re looking for that lovely golden brown color and a set center. A toothpick should come out with a few moist crumbs for the perfect texture!
Lastly, let it cool for a few minutes before serving. This helps the layers set a bit more, making it easier to scoop out those delicious slices. Trust me, patience is key here!
Variations of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ake
The beauty of this strawberry cheesecake dump cake is its versatility! You can easily switch things up to suit your taste or the season. For a fun twist, try using fresh blueberries or peaches instead of strawberries. Just make sure to adjust the sweetness based on the fruit you choose!
If you’re a chocolate lover like me, consider adding chocolate chips to the cream cheese mixture. It adds a rich, decadent layer that pairs wonderfully with the fruity taste. You could even mix in a bit of cocoa powder into the cake mix for a chocolatey base!
Feeling adventurous? Try adding a splash of almond extract along with the vanilla for a delightful flavor twist. The options are endless, so feel free to get creative and make this dump cake your own!

FAQ Section
Q1. Can I use fresh strawberries instead of pie filling?
Absolutely! Using fresh strawberries will give your strawberry cheesecake dump cake a vibrant flavor. Just chop them up and mix with a bit of sugar to enhance their sweetness and let them sit for a few minutes before spreading them in the baking dish.
Q2. How should I store leftovers?
If you have any leftovers (which is rare, trust me!), store them in an airtight container in the fridge. It’ll stay fresh for about 3-4 days, but I doubt it’ll last that long because everyone will want a slice!
Q3. Can I make this dump cake 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the layers ahead of time and assemble them just before baking. This makes it a perfect make-ahead dessert for gatherings. Just keep the assembled dish covered in the fridge until you’re ready to pop it in the oven!
Q4. Is this recipe gluten-free?
Unfortunately, this strawberry cheesecake dump cake isn’t gluten-free as it uses yellow cake mix. However, you can substitute a gluten-free cake mix to create a delicious gluten-free version that still captures all the flavors.
